Transaction 43e636a6c3c8ca7df2d96ddfdc279a74396248208f5bb14be12f6cfaf095e237
1 Input
1 Output
-
43e636a6c3c8ca7df2d96ddfdc279a74396248208f5bb14be12f6cfaf095e237:0
- value
- 84854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1318f59ae6030df891b99a145f1fa54551a086f9 OP_EQUAL
- address
- 33RzfQ24zhF5e6d8McC3qYnqo2o4M2rijw